IQUB is a protein coding gene. May play roles in cilia formation and/or maintenance.

Protein Aliases: FLJ35834; IQ and ubiquitin-like domain-containing protein; IQ motif and ubiquitin-like domain-containing protein
Gene Aliases: 4932408B21Rik; IQUB; Trs4
UniProt ID: (Human) Q8NA54, (Mouse) Q8CDK3
Entrez Gene ID: (Human) 154865, (Mouse) 214704
